Are you looking to freshen up your carpets but don't have a vacuum on hand? Don't worry, there are still effective ways to clean your carpets without a vacuum. Follow these expert tips for DIY carpet cleaning without a vacuum.
1. Start with a Good Shake
Take your carpet outside and give it a good shake to loosen and remove dirt and debris. Hang it over a railing or clothesline and beat it with a broom to further dislodge any trapped dirt.
2. Use a Carpet Brush or Broom
If you don't have a vacuum, a carpet brush or broom can be a great alternative. Use the brush to scrub the carpet fibers in different directions to loosen dirt and pet hair. Then, use a dustpan and brush to collect the debris.
3. Try Baking Soda
Baking soda is a powerful odor absorber and can help freshen up your carpets. Sprinkle a generous amount of baking soda over the carpet, let it sit for a few hours, and then vacuum it up. If you don't have a vacuum, you can use a brush to sweep up the baking soda.
4. Use a Damp Cloth
If you have small stains on your carpet, a damp cloth can work wonders. Blot the stain with a cloth dampened with a mixture of water and mild detergent. Avoid rubbing the stain, as this can spread it further.
5. Steam Clean with a Towel
If you have a steam iron, you can create a DIY steam cleaner for your carpet. Fill the iron with water, set it to the steam setting, and run it over the carpet while pressing the steam button. Place a towel under the iron to collect the dirt and moisture.
6. Use a Carpet Sweeper
A carpet sweeper is a manual tool that can effectively clean carpets without the need for electricity. Simply push the sweeper over the carpet to collect dirt, dust, and debris. Empty the sweeper regularly to ensure optimal cleaning.
